In the wild, Orioles and Cardinals might not be natural rivals, but on the baseball field they are.

On Tuesday, July 12, at the Barrhead Sports grounds, the St. Albert Cardinals proved they were at the top of the predatory chain, at least for one game, as they defeated the home team Orioles by a score of 11 - 5.

The Cardinals got off to a quick start, scoring three runs in the top half of the first inning. The Orioles responded in the bottom half of the inning by scoring two of their own after right fielder, Logan Brandon, and pitcher, Lee Worobec, crossed the plate.

Unfortunately for the Orioles, that is as close as they would get. St. Albert added to their total in the second and third innings, scoring a run both innings and holding Barrhead scoreless.

In the fourth inning the teams exchanged two runs apiece and in the fifth inning the Cardinals outscored Barrhead two runs to one.

In the final two innings, St. Albert scored three more runs to finish the night.

So far this season the Cardinals are the only team who has been able to defeat the Orioles. In their first meeting on April 30, the Cardinals won 7-0 and June 12 they won 1-0. In both of those games the Orioles were the visiting team.
